Output 61230da71bfd806ec92b938562a8f26ab4f02ae3ccd871eb19afdb5069516285:0

value
306303
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d76fa75de68b689a13cd0a245a7dd91c6f71f4fc OP_EQUAL
address
3ML8xdMpBCK24aPeQ7rU6gqTRxzFb47Rr6
transaction
61230da71bfd806ec92b938562a8f26ab4f02ae3ccd871eb19afdb5069516285
confirmations
225889
spent
true